Who regulates the control of animals?

The Regional District can regulate the control of animals but does not. The following applies in the District: If you wish to keep animals off your property you MUST build a fence to keep them out.

Who has jurisdiction over drainage problems?

In many instances, drainage problems crop up due to change in run-off patterns resulting from new roads, ditching, land clearing and the like. Your first inquiry should be at the Ministry of Transportation and Highways, if you think their drainage system is causing the problem. The Water Management of the Ministry of Water, Land and Air Protection may also be able to assist you.

Where can I get maps of the area?

Zoning, subdivision, legal and house number maps are available at the Regional District. A check with the planning department will tell you the prices, scales and dates of compilation, etc.

Topographic maps which show elevation, landforms and some trails and roads are available at book stores or sporting goods stores.

Most of the local book stores carry trail guides for those wanting strictly hiking and camping maps.

What permits do I need to set up a business?

In the Regional District, no business licence is required, but you must have the correct zoning to allow you to operate your proposed business. Check with the Regional District about zoning regulations.

Within the municipalities of Tofino, Ucluelet and Port Alberni you require a business licence. Check with the appropriate municipal office.
